Unfortunately we had a very disappointing stay at Fort Rapids. Before our stay, I had read negative reviews on yelp and google but didn't take them seriously. I wish I had!

Online reviews from previous unhappy patrons mentioned that the line to check in to the hotel was very long and slow moving. I found this to be absolutely true. My daughter loves water parks and our family has stayed at many. I have never had to wait in a line like that simply to check in at any other water park resort.

Inside the water park there were empty pizza boxes and trays of half eaten food all over the place. I saw a half eaten hamburger lying on the floor. It looked as though no one was on staff to maintain the cleanliness of the area. Further the next morning when we returned to the water park I saw a piece of pepperoni lying on the ground with ants crawling all over it. This was first thing in the morning when the water park had just been opened and things should have been spotless. I was really turned off by the general lack of cleanliness in that space. Plus at other resorts there is often a designated area for eating, which keeps the food mess contained; there isn't just food strewn about everywhere. The cleanliness alone is reason enough to not return but we experienced other issues.

The high speed internet did not work in our room. I called the front desk to ask for help with this and the most they could do was give me a password. The problem was simply that the signal was too weak for any of our devices to reliably pick up, so we actually did not have high speed internet in our room. If the signal is too weak to reach our room; than we can't use it, plain and simple. Saying that we would have access to high speed internet in our room was, at best, misleading in this case.

Finally I was very surprised to learn that the water park doesn't open until 10am and check out is at 11am. On the day we were checking out that left us with about half an hour to enjoy the park before having to deal with getting everything out of our room. Plus for that half hour we were there we couldn't go on the only 2 slides my daughter wanted to use because there were no life guards on duty at those slides. I understand that patrons are allowed to stay in the water park after they have checked out, but sometimes you aren't able to do that or don't want to deal with changing in the grungy locker rooms. All the other water parks we have stayed at previously open at 9am and have a full staff on duty at that time so that guests of the resort can enjoy the water park in the morning before having to deal with check out. For my family this was the final disappointment. I asked if there was a manger around that I could share my dissatisfaction with but no manager was available.

I don't usually write negative on line reviews, However Fort Rapids is the most poorly run water park I have ever visited and I don't want other families to waste their money like we did.
